| Color Palette | Cloud White, Soft Sage, and Light Oak Wood Tones |
|---|---|
| Materials | Natural Beech Wood, Matte Black Hardware, and White Quartz Countertops |
| Lighting | Maximize natural light with sheer window treatments; add oversized minimalist dome pendant lights in matte finishes for functional warmth. |
| Best For | Real estate professionals marketing vacant luxury condos or suburban homes seeking a clean, high-end, and universally appealing aesthetic. |

How does virtual staging impact the marketing budget compared to traditional staging?
Virtual staging is significantly more cost-effective, typically costing a fraction of traditional staging. While physical furniture rental and moving can cost thousands per month, virtual staging requires a one-time fee per image, drastically improving your ROI while maintaining a premium look.
What are the biggest design challenges when staging an empty property kitchen?
The primary challenge is scale and warmth; empty kitchens often look smaller and more clinical than they are. Scandinavian design solves this by using light woods and 'hygge' elements to make the space feel larger and more inviting, bridging the gap between a vacant shell and a dream home.
How quickly can I get virtual staging done for my listing?
Most professional virtual staging services offer a turnaround time of 24 to 48 hours. This allows real estate agents to list a property almost immediately after photography, ensuring that the momentum of a new listing is captured while the kitchen looks its absolute best.
